C370 XNG is a 1985 Austin Mini 1000 City E in Green with a 998cc petrol engine. This vehicle has been through 20 MOT tests with a personal pass rate of 65%.
Across all 1985 Austin Mini 1000 City E models, the average MOT pass rate is 65.1% with a typical mileage of 53,264 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Austin Mini 1000 City E fails its MOT is subframe mounting prescribed area is excessively corroded, accounting for 3,881 recorded failures. If you're considering buying C370 XNG, it's worth having these areas checked by a mechanic before committing.
The Austin Mini 1000 City E typically stays on UK roads for around 44 years. At 41 years old, this Austin Mini 1000 City E is approaching the upper end of the typical lifespan for this model.
